Post Hoc

A

Mistaking sequence for cause
Just because one event happens before the other doesn’t mean the first event caused the second

Major Premise

A

General statement believed to be true

17
Q

Minor Premise

A

Presents specific example of the belief stated in the major premise

18
Q

Conclusion

A

Logically drawn inference based on the premises

Syllogism is Valid When

A

Its conclusion follow the premises

20
Q

Syllogism is True When

A

It makes accurate claims
Information is consistent with the facts

21
Q

Syllogism is Sound When

A

Valid and true
